Class AssemblyProvidedOperationPassedEvent<T extends org.palladiosimulator.pcm.core.composition.AssemblyContext,R extends org.palladiosimulator.pcm.repository.ProvidedRole,S extends org.palladiosimulator.pcm.repository.Signature>

java.lang.Object
org.palladiosimulator.simulizar.interpreter.listener.ModelElementPassedEvent<T>
org.palladiosimulator.simulizar.interpreter.listener.AssemblyProvidedOperationPassedEvent<T,R,S>
Type Parameters:
T -
R -
S -

public class AssemblyProvidedOperationPassedEvent<T extends org.palladiosimulator.pcm.core.composition.AssemblyContext,R extends org.palladiosimulator.pcm.repository.ProvidedRole,S extends org.palladiosimulator.pcm.repository.Signature> extends ModelElementPassedEvent<T>
Event for the AssemblyProvidedOperation, which needs three elements to be identified: AssemblyContext, ProvidedRoel, Signature.
  • Constructor Details

    • AssemblyProvidedOperationPassedEvent

      public AssemblyProvidedOperationPassedEvent(R providedRole, EventType eventType, de.uka.ipd.sdq.simucomframework.Context context, S signature, T assemblyContext)
  • Method Details

    • getProvidedRole

      public R getProvidedRole()
    • getSignature

      public S getSignature()
    • getAssemblyContext

      public T getAssemblyContext()